Output 653922241c543aba091fd2a0295ef0e5ccee03081f8d6e20cf4cb84fc0d19c00:0

value
68869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f986ffc7041d15d2a67a839504379856db98f6 OP_EQUAL
address
3C5fCgdiarp1jnpxjYk3dQw4VXHJKGV1BX
transaction
653922241c543aba091fd2a0295ef0e5ccee03081f8d6e20cf4cb84fc0d19c00
spent
true